Balangir: Tension prevailed in a hospital at Titlagarh in Odisha’s Balangir district on Thursday following the death of a woman patient over alleged medical negligence.

The deceased has been identified as Binodini Chhatar (25), wife of Bimal Chhatar of Sihini village in the district. The woman had recently delivered a stillborn baby and was having complications.

ADVERTISEMENT

While the exact cause of death is yet to be ascertained, family members of the deceased alleged that the woman was given the wrong injection. They claimed that Binodini died barely five minutes after the injection was administered.

According to reports, Binodini was pregnant and was admitted to Mother and Child Hospital on February 2. The next day, the family was told that she had delivered a stillborn baby. As Binodini developed some health issues, she was again admitted to the hospital.

However, her condition deteriorated on Thursday and the doctor on duty administered an injection to her in the morning. Minutes later, the woman reportedly died after which angry family members and relatives staged a protest in the hospital.

On being informed, a police team visited the spot and tried to pacify the protesters with assurances of strict action after discussion with medical authorities. Investigation has been initiated and the exact cause of death will be established after getting the postmortem report.  a police official said.
